{"release":{"id":"DR1","released_on":"2026-08-21","doi":null,"url":"https://spacecatalog.org/releases#dr1"},"epoch":{"requested":"now","label":"J2026.680","julian_year":2026.68,"time":"2026-09-06T05:32:02.084Z","years_from_j2000":26.68,"frame":"date","applied":"Proper motion, then precession and nutation. The catalogued J2000 position is carried along the great circle the object's own published motion puts it on, at a constant velocity, and the result is referred to the true equator and equinox of this instant. Those are separate things: the motion moves the object, and the rotation turns the grid under it by about fifty arcseconds a year, with nutation adding up to another seventeen.","excluded":"Parallax, the radial-velocity perspective term, aberration and refraction; each is below the accuracy of the catalogued positions themselves. An object with no published proper motion comes back where the catalogue has it rather than at a fabricated zero, and says so with a null pm_ra_mas_yr. A body with no fixed position is not propagated at all — its place comes from an ephemeris, which is what /api/v1/visible answers with."},"slug":"hat-p-64-b","name":"HAT-P-64 b","class":"gas_giant","category":"exoplanet","object_type":"Gas giant","mag":null,"mag_band":null,"abs_mag":null,"abs_mag_band":null,"distance_ly":2126.203641644119,"distance_method":"NASA Exoplanet Archive sy_dist (TICv8, 2019AJ....158..138S)","ra_deg":68.9743955,"dec_deg":2.4312732,"epoch_ra_deg":69.324554,"epoch_dec_deg":2.486644,"epoch_moved_arcsec":null,"pm_ra_mas_yr":null,"pm_dec_mas_yr":null,"orbits":"HAT-P-64","semi_major_axis_km":8058837.294609,"periapsis_km":null,"mass_kg":1.1009122678588978e+27,"mass_msun":0.000553665,"constellation":"Taurus","discovered":"2021","featured":false,"url":"https://spacecatalog.org/object/hat-p-64-b","radius_km":121750.875650553,"radius_kind":null,"data_quality":null,"description":null,"properties":{"host_star":"HAT-P-64","host_v_mag":12.855,"uncertainties":{"mass_kg":[2.4675619796837367e+26,3.4166242795620975e+26],"radius_km":[5004.4399925650005,5004.4399925650005],"distance_ly":[48.03631131012197,50.270482497481666],"host_mass_solar":[0.021,0.021],"inclination_deg":[0.7,0.7],"host_radius_solar":[0.028,0.041],"host_temperature_k":[29,29],"semi_major_axis_km":[44879.361209999995,44879.361209999995],"orbital_period_days":[0.0000017,0.0000017]},"host_mass_solar":1.298,"inclination_deg":88.01,"stars_in_system":1,"discovery_method":"Transit","host_radius_solar":1.735,"planets_in_system":1,"discovery_facility":"HATNet","host_temperature_k":6457,"orbital_period_days":4.007232,"transit_midpoint_bjd":2457751.46354,"eccentricity_upper_limit":0.101,"equilibrium_temperature_k":1766},"designations":[{"catalog":"Exoplanet","designation":"HAT-P-64 b"},{"catalog":"Host star","designation":"HAT-P-64"}],"source":{"id":"exoplanet_archive","name":"NASA Exoplanet Archive (Planetary Systems Composite Parameters)","url":"https://exoplanetarchive.ipac.caltech.edu/cgi-bin/TblView/nph-tblView?app=ExoTbls&config=PSCompPars","license":"Public domain (NASA)"},"updated_at":"2026-09-02T19:50:56.720Z","attribution":"Data from SpaceCatalog.org.
